Matthew’s Ministry Family Night Out (FNO) offers a free evening of respite for parents and caregivers of individuals with special needs. Participants are paired with volunteers for a fun night of themed activities, including dinner, games, crafts, and a movie. All ages are welcome, as well as siblings (ages 12 years and younger) of those with special needs. Registration required.
